Perrie Leizear (b. 1809 - d. 1897)
MSA SC 5496-036779
Sheriff, Montgomery County, Maryland, 1862

Biography:

    Born 1808, in Montgomery County Maryland, to parents Elias and Mary Sullivan Leizear, Perrie Leizear was a respected member of the Sandy Spring community. While a carpenter by trade, he served as Sheriff of Montgomery County1862-1865 and in other public capacities to include Deputy Sheriff and Comptroller for Montgomery County District 5.  His marriage to Susan Murphy produced three children Mary Ann, Francis Thomas, and William Perrie.  A second marriage to Elizabeth E. Grimes produced no children. He died July 14, 1897 and although not a Quaker he is buried in the Friends Meeting House cemetery in Sandy Spring Maryland.
